Legal Terms to Know in Criminal Defense

Understanding legal terminology can help you better navigate your case. Below are some commonly used terms related to criminal defense and their definitions to assist you in comprehending the legal process.

Felony

A felony is a serious crime that usually carries penalties of imprisonment for more than one year. Examples include robbery, assault, and certain drug offenses. Felony charges require careful legal handling due to their severe consequences.

Bail Hearing

A bail hearing is a court proceeding where the judge decides whether to release the accused before trial and under what conditions. This process assesses the risk of flight and potential danger to the community.

Misdemeanor

A misdemeanor is a less serious crime than a felony, often punishable by fines or imprisonment for less than one year. Examples include petty theft or minor assaults. Proper defense can often lead to reduced penalties or alternative resolutions.

Probation Revocation Hearing

A probation revocation hearing occurs when there is an allegation that a person on probation violated the terms set by the court. The hearing determines whether probation should be revoked and if additional penalties should be imposed.

Frequently Asked Questions About Criminal Defense in Bath

What should I do if I am arrested in Bath?

If you are arrested, it is important to remain calm and exercise your right to remain silent until you have spoken with a lawyer. Avoid making statements or signing documents without legal advice to protect your rights. Contacting a criminal defense lawyer as soon as possible helps ensure that your case is handled properly and your interests are defended from the outset.
